The current British king George VI was called "Berty" by his family, and before he ascended the throne, he was called "Prince Albert" by the public. He was the second son of George V and Queen Mary. In 1920, he became Duke of York, Earl of Inverness and Baron Killarney. It seemed that he had no chance of inheriting the throne because of his elder brother. The very popular and intelligent Crown Edward was ahead of him in the succession ranking.
Because of this, Prince Albert was allowed to serve in the Royal Navy during World War I and had greater freedom when choosing a wife. In 1923, he finally married Elizabeth Bosleon after being rejected many times. Since they were unlikely to inherit the throne, the couple was able to raise their two daughters, Elizabeth and Margrit in a relatively normal environment.
Albert was very shy and suffered from severe stuttering throughout his life. He was very unhappy when he learned that his brother who succeeded to the throne in 1936 was finally decided to abdicate for marriage and would inherit the throne. On May 12, 1937, he ascended the throne at Westminster Abbey. He changed his name to George VI. In this way, he followed Queen Victoria's last wishes. After ascending the throne, all British monarchs could not be named "Albert". On the other hand, they also rebuilt public confidence in the royal family by using the same name as his father.
Two years later, World War II broke out, and the low-famous royal family hoped to be a role model for leading the country to victory, and they were indeed an important factor in maintaining the fighting spirit of the British people during World War II.
